Bonfit Sport a division of Bonfit America is the Exclusive Distributorship of Brush-t worldwide. The Brush-t “brush tee” series was developed by South African Design Engineer and golfer, Jason Crouse. His concept was to replicate the feel of grass and reduce the interference associated with hitting off a wooden or plastic tee. The Brush-t exceeded Crouse’s expectations. The synthetic bristles do provide a natural strike, but more importantly reduced resistance to improve distance and reduced sidespin to increase accuracy. The Brush-t was thoroughly tested at an independent testing facility in southern California and the findings showed that the tee consistently outperformed wooden tees for greater distance and reduced spin. The Brush-t was found to impart 2% less deviation on the ball which leads to straighter, more accurate drives. In addition, it showed less resistance at impact and therefore added between 3.2 and 7 yards to driving distance. These tests were carried out using the Iron Byron swing tester to help ensure greater consistency. After receiving official approval from the USGA and the R&A, the company introduced the Brush-t to the South African market and soon expanded to Europe and the United States. The Brush-t is available in 4 different models to accommodate clubs from fairway woods to oversize drivers. Professional golfers on all Tours have discovered the benefits of using Brush-t and have taken advantage of the greater distance and accuracy it provides.
